Foxfield station may not boast a grandiose façade or array of high-tech facilities, but it caters well to the essentials. The station does not have a ticket office, but you will find convenient ticket machines for collecting pre-purchased tickets, ensuring a seamless start to your journey. Accessibility has been thoughtfully considered, with ticket machines designed to accommodate those with disabilities. The availability of an induction loop at the ticket machine is also a thoughtful touch.
You'll have to plan ahead for refreshments and personal conveniences as the station does not offer shops, cafes, or even basic amenities like toilets. However, there is a seating area to relax in while waiting for your train's arrival. Although staff presence is absent, a dedicated helpline is available for any immediate assistance required during your travels.
Step-free access is partially available, making it friendly for wheelchairs and scooters, albeit with some steep ramps. Despite the absence of staff assistance on site, the conductors are trained to help passengers board with the aid of wheelchair ramps carried on each train. This service is backed by Passenger Assist, which allows you to book assistance in advance, even just two hours before your journey.
When it comes to onward travel, Foxfield station keeps it uncomplicated yet entirely connected. Although bicycle hire is not an option directly from the station, the local rail replacement service offers reliable pick-up and drop-off at bus stops on Foxfield Road. Taxis are your best option for private transport needs, and further information can be found readily via the Northern Railway website's taxi resource.

The station is equipped with essential amenities, ensuring a smooth travel experience. While there's no ticket office service on Sundays, travelers can use the convenient ticket machines available daily. For online ticket purchases, collection is a breeze using these machines. Accessibility is a key feature at the station, with step-free access throughout and designated areas for those with mobility impairments.
Although there are no toilets or shopping facilities on-site, the station ensures safety and comfort with seating areas, CCTV cameras, and customer help points available. For cyclists, there are ample bicycle storage facilities, including the option to hire a Brompton bike, perfect for exploring the town and its surroundings.
Henley-on-Thames station offers numerous onward travel options. Whether you're catching a bus, hailing a taxi, or considering hiring a bicycle, you'll find convenient services to suit your needs. For air travelers, links are available via nearby Reading station, connecting to Heathrow and Gatwick airports.
